Career Services for Graduate Students

The Steinbright Career Development Center provides Drexel graduate students with important resources and services for career and job search support for both campus and online students.

Steinbright Career Development Center Services

Advancing your career is one of the most important reasons for going to graduate school. With research, preparation, and perseverance, and with the guidance of Steinbright's Career Services, you can achieve your career objectives. Steinbright provides individual sessions for graduate students, workshops on important topics relevant to your job search, and various events that connect you with employers. The Steinbright Career Development Center supports students with the following and more.

  • Career assessment and counseling
  • Job search skills
  • Interview preparation
  • Resume and Curriculum Vitae (CV) critique
  • LinkedIn profile review
  • Salary negotiations
  • Professional networking strategies
  • Researching employers and organizations

Handshake

Handshake is a job board with postings from employers who are specifically seeking Drexel University students and alumni. Handshake connects students with over 500,000 employers, including all companies on the Fortune 500 list. Along with job opportunities, the Handshake platform allows you to contact employers directly for informational interviews and other opportunities. You can also read reviews by other Drexel students and alumni about their experiences with an employer and connect on Handshake to further expand your network.
